WebSep 11, 2013 · The Logout Button plugin uses the default log out functionality provided by WP through wp_loginout (). It checks to see if the user is logged in. If the user is logged in, a Log Out link will be displayed to them. If the user is not logged in, nothing will be shown to the user. Future releases will include the ability to choose “Themes”.
